git远程分支代码开发
-
远程分支是Git中非常常用的功能之一,它可以使多人协同开发成为可能。下面是一些关于如何在Git中进行远程分支代码开发的步骤:
1. 查看远程分支:在使用Git进行代码开发之前,首先需要查看远程分支的状态。可以使用以下命令来查看远程分支的列表:
“`
git branch -r
“`这会列出远程仓库中的所有分支。
2. 创建本地分支:一般情况下,我们是在本地分支上进行代码开发的。因此,在开始开发之前,需要创建一个本地分支。可以使用以下命令来创建本地分支:
“`
git checkout -b
“`其中`
`是一个自定义的分支名字。 3. 关联远程分支:创建本地分支之后,我们需要将其与远程分支进行关联,这样才能进行代码的推送与拉取操作。可以使用以下命令来将本地分支与远程分支进行关联:
“`
git push -u origin
“`这会将本地分支推送到远程仓库,并且设置本地分支与远程分支的关联关系。
4. 进行代码开发:现在可以在本地分支上进行代码开发了。可以使用常规的Git操作,如提交代码、修改代码等。
5. 推送代码:当你完成了一部分代码开发后,可以使用以下命令将代码推送到远程分支:
“`
git push origin
“`这会将本地分支上的代码推送到远程分支。
6. 拉取代码:如果有其他人在远程分支上进行了代码开发,并且你想获取最新的代码,可以使用以下命令将远程分支的代码拉取到本地分支:
“`
git pull origin
“`这会将远程分支的最新代码更新到本地分支。
7. 合并代码:在进行代码开发过程中,可能会存在多个人在同一个分支上进行开发的情况。当你想将自己的代码合并到主分支上时,可以使用以下命令进行代码合并:
“`
git merge
“`其中`
`是你想合并的分支名字。 总结:通过以上几个步骤,你就可以在Git中进行远程分支代码开发了。记住,及时的与远程分支保持同步,合理地使用分支,可以提高多人协同开发的效率。
2年前 -
在进行git远程分支代码开发时,有几个重要的步骤和注意事项需要遵循。
1. 创建远程分支:首先,在本地仓库中创建一个新的分支,然后将其推送到远程仓库。可以使用以下命令创建并推送一个新分支:
“`
$ git branch// 创建本地分支
$ git push origin// 将分支推送到远程仓库
“`2. 切换到远程分支:要在本地进行远程分支代码的开发,需要切换到这个远程分支。可以使用以下命令进行切换:
“`
$ git checkout// 切换到远程分支
“`3. 开发代码并提交:在切换到远程分支后,可以进行代码的开发工作。一旦完成了一个新的功能或修复了一个bug,可以使用以下命令提交代码:
“`
$ git add// 将修改的文件添加到暂存区
$ git commit -m “” // 提交代码,并附带一条清晰的提交信息
“`4. 同步远程分支:由于多人协作开发的情况下,其他人也可能在同一个远程分支上提交代码。因此,为了避免冲突并保持代码的同步,我们需要定期拉取远程分支上的代码。可以使用以下命令拉取最新的远程分支代码:
“`
$ git fetch origin // 拉取远程分支的更新
$ git merge origin/// 将远程分支的代码合并到当前分支
“`5. 解决代码冲突:在多人协作开发的过程中,有可能会出现代码冲突。当拉取远程分支代码或合并分支时,如果存在冲突,需要手动解决冲突。可以使用工具或编辑器来解决冲突,并使用以下命令标记冲突已解决:
“`
$ git add// 将解决冲突的文件添加到暂存区
“`通过以上步骤和注意事项,可以实现git远程分支代码的开发,并与团队保持代码的同步和协作。在多人协作开发时,及时沟通和良好的代码管理实践也是至关重要的。
2年前 -
一、创建远程分支
1. 首先,使用git branch命令在本地创建一个新的分支。例如,如果要创建一个名为”dev”的分支,可以运行以下命令:
“`
git branch dev
“`
2. 然后,使用git checkout命令切换到新创建的分支上:
“`
git checkout dev
“`
3. 现在,我们将该本地分支推送到远程仓库。运行以下命令将”dev”分支推送到远程仓库(例如GitHub):
“`
git push -u origin dev
“`
这里,-u选项用于将远程分支与本地分支进行关联,使远程分支成为默认的上游分支。二、在远程分支上进行代码开发
1. 现在,我们可以在本地切换到”dev”分支上,开始进行代码开发。
“`
git checkout dev
“`
2. 开发完成后,可以使用git add命令添加修改的文件到暂存区:
“`
git add…
“`
或者,可以使用git add .命令将所有修改的文件都添加到暂存区。
3. 接下来,使用git commit命令提交暂存区中的修改:
“`
git commit -m “commit message”
“`
在”commit message”中填写本次提交的信息。
4. 现在,我们可以使用git push命令将本地的修改推送到远程”dev”分支:
“`
git push origin dev
“`
5. 如果其他团队成员也在同时开发这个远程分支上,我们可以使用git pull命令,在推送之前先拉取远程分支上的最新代码:
“`
git pull origin dev
“`
这样可以避免代码冲突。
6. 如果在拉取代码的过程中发生冲突,需要手动解决冲突。打开冲突文件,查找标记为”<<<<<<<"、"======="和">>>>>>>”的冲突标记,根据需要手动修改文件内容。解决冲突后,使用git add命令将修改的文件添加到暂存区,然后使用git commit命令提交修改。
7. 当我们的代码开发完成后,可以通过向主分支发起合并请求来将远程分支上的代码合并到主分支(例如”master”分支)上。三、删除远程分支
在某些情况下,当我们完成了远程分支的开发并将代码合并到主分支上后,可以删除远程分支以保持项目仓库的整洁。使用以下命令删除远程分支:
“`
git push origin –delete dev
“`
这将删除名为”dev”的远程分支。注意,这个操作不会删除本地分支,只会删除远程仓库中的分支。总结:通过以上步骤,我们可以在Git中进行远程分支代码开发。首先创建远程分支并将其推送到远程仓库,然后在本地分支上进行代码开发,并使用git push命令将修改推送到远程分支。在需要时,可以使用git pull命令拉取最新代码并解决冲突。最后,将代码合并到主分支上并删除不再需要的远程分支。
2年前